1// SPDX-License-Identifier: GPL-2.0-only2/*3 * ltc2485.c - Driver for Linear Technology LTC2485 ADC4 *5 * Copyright (C) 2016 Alison Schofield <amsfield22@gmail.com>6 *7 * Datasheet: http://cds.linear.com/docs/en/datasheet/2485fd.pdf8 */9 10#include <linux/delay.h>11#include <linux/i2c.h>12#include <linux/module.h>13 14#include <linux/iio/iio.h>15#include <linux/iio/sysfs.h>16 17/* Power-on configuration: rejects both 50/60Hz, operates at 1x speed */18#define LTC2485_CONFIG_DEFAULT 019 20struct ltc2485_data {21 struct i2c_client *client;22 ktime_t time_prev; /* last conversion */23};24 25static void ltc2485_wait_conv(struct ltc2485_data *data)26{27 const unsigned int conv_time = 147; /* conversion time ms */28 unsigned int time_elapsed;29 30 /* delay if conversion time not passed since last read or write */31 time_elapsed = ktime_ms_delta(ktime_get(), data->time_prev);32 33 if (time_elapsed < conv_time)34 msleep(conv_time - time_elapsed);35}36 37static int ltc2485_read(struct ltc2485_data *data, int *val)38{39 struct i2c_client *client = data->client;40 __be32 buf = 0;41 int ret;42 43 ltc2485_wait_conv(data);44 45 ret = i2c_master_recv(client, (char *)&buf, 4);46 if (ret < 0) {47 dev_err(&client->dev, "i2c_master_recv failed\n");48 return ret;49 }50 data->time_prev = ktime_get();51 *val = sign_extend32(be32_to_cpu(buf) >> 6, 24);52 53 return ret;54}55 56static int ltc2485_read_raw(struct iio_dev *indio_dev,57 struct iio_chan_spec const *chan,58 int *val, int *val2, long mask)59{60 struct ltc2485_data *data = iio_priv(indio_dev);61 int ret;62 63 if (mask == IIO_CHAN_INFO_RAW) {64 ret = ltc2485_read(data, val);65 if (ret < 0)66 return ret;67 68 return IIO_VAL_INT;69 70 } else if (mask == IIO_CHAN_INFO_SCALE) {71 *val = 5000; /* on board vref millivolts */72 *val2 = 25; /* 25 (24 + sign) data bits */73 return IIO_VAL_FRACTIONAL_LOG2;74 75 } else {76 return -EINVAL;77 }78}79 80static const struct iio_chan_spec ltc2485_channel[] = {81 {82 .type = IIO_VOLTAGE,83 .info_mask_separate = BIT(IIO_CHAN_INFO_RAW),84 .info_mask_shared_by_type = BIT(IIO_CHAN_INFO_SCALE)85 },86};87 88static const struct iio_info ltc2485_info = {89 .read_raw = ltc2485_read_raw,90};91 92static int ltc2485_probe(struct i2c_client *client)93{94 const struct i2c_device_id *id = i2c_client_get_device_id(client);95 struct iio_dev *indio_dev;96 struct ltc2485_data *data;97 int ret;98 99 if (!i2c_check_functionality(client->adapter, I2C_FUNC_I2C |100 I2C_FUNC_SMBUS_WRITE_BYTE))101 return -EOPNOTSUPP;102 103 indio_dev = devm_iio_device_alloc(&client->dev, sizeof(*data));104 if (!indio_dev)105 return -ENOMEM;106 107 data = iio_priv(indio_dev);108 i2c_set_clientdata(client, indio_dev);109 data->client = client;110 111 indio_dev->name = id->name;112 indio_dev->info = <c2485_info;113 indio_dev->modes = INDIO_DIRECT_MODE;114 indio_dev->channels = ltc2485_channel;115 indio_dev->num_channels = ARRAY_SIZE(ltc2485_channel);116 117 ret = i2c_smbus_write_byte(data->client, LTC2485_CONFIG_DEFAULT);118 if (ret < 0)119 return ret;120 121 data->time_prev = ktime_get();122 123 return devm_iio_device_register(&client->dev, indio_dev);124}125 126static const struct i2c_device_id ltc2485_id[] = {127 { "ltc2485" },128 { }129};130MODULE_DEVICE_TABLE(i2c, ltc2485_id);131 132static struct i2c_driver ltc2485_driver = {133 .driver = {134 .name = "ltc2485",135 },136 .probe = ltc2485_probe,137 .id_table = ltc2485_id,138};139module_i2c_driver(ltc2485_driver);140 141MODULE_AUTHOR("Alison Schofield <amsfield22@gmail.com>");142MODULE_DESCRIPTION("Linear Technology LTC2485 ADC driver");143MODULE_LICENSE("GPL v2");144
